Output f579b66904280b53aa65e065aa09c25f04878c147b134f2cb201b1d4d75ae81a:1

value
631483620
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48825ad952cd5908aed79ebc5a2f0e3df5dda8c9 OP_EQUALVERIFY OP_CHECKSIG
address
17cPp2be6BPLXbX8zDG1fmCji69vmUR5y2
transaction
f579b66904280b53aa65e065aa09c25f04878c147b134f2cb201b1d4d75ae81a
spent
true